Which of the following was a benefit of living under the Inca government?

A. The sick and poor were provided food and medical care.
B. Humans were sacrificed to the gods to benefit the society.
C. The deceased were buried in mounds.
D. Kivas were constructed to provide a place to worship gods.

A benefit of living under the Inca government was that the sick and the poor were provided food and medical care. It is also known that the Kivas were constructed to provide a place to worship Gods.
